Hong-Jiang Zhang (Dr. Hongjiang Zhang) serves as a Venture Partner at Source Code Capital, a Beijing-based venture firm founded in 2014, having joined the company in December 2016 after previously serving as the CEO of Kingsoft Corp.. His investment focus centers on artificial intelligence, where he argues that true AI companies must own and consistently generate proprietary data, with key opportunities lying in “Intelligence+” capabilities, the AI ecosystem, and data-talent infrastructure. Source Code Capital generally targets early- and growth-stage technology companies across sectors including AI, robotics, intelligent manufacturing, internet services, and biotechnology, primarily within China. While Zhang’s specific check size and lead/follow behavior are not publicly detailed, his firm’s portfolio includes major Chinese startups such as ByteDance, Meituan, Li Auto, and Niu Technologies. Zhang holds an independent non-executive director role at XPeng Inc. and serves as a Senior Advisor at The Carlyle Group, reflecting his deep ties to both venture and corporate leadership.
